Single ply membranes are flexible sheets of rubber or plastic used primarily on flat or low-slope roofs. They are lightweight and designed to provide a continuous, seamless layer that keeps water out. These systems are popular for their longevity and ability to withstand extreme weather. Metal roof panels for Baltimore homes are durable sheets of metal, like steel or aluminum, installed to protect your roof. Licensed pros carefully measure, cut, and secure these panels, often over an existing underlayment. They ensure proper overlap and sealing at seams and edges to prevent leaks. Proper installation is key to their longevity and performance in our weather.
Roofing tar, or asphalt-based sealant, is used in Baltimore for sealing small cracks, joints, and around penetrations like vents or chimneys. It creates a waterproof barrier to prevent leaks. Licensed pros apply it carefully to affected areas, ensuring a tight seal. While effective for minor repairs, it’s important to know when a more comprehensive solution is needed.
Roof installation in Baltimore varies significantly by material. For asphalt shingles, it involves overlapping layers. Metal roofs require precise panel alignment and fastening. Flat or low-slope roofs might use single-ply membranes or rolled roofing, each with its own installation method. Licensed pros understand these differences, ensuring each material is installed correctly for optimal performance in our climate.

TPO (thermoplastic olefin) roofing is a popular single-ply membrane for flat or low-slope roofs, and it's common in Baltimore. It’s known for its durability, energy efficiency, and resistance to UV rays and punctures. Licensed pros expertly install and repair TPO, ensuring seams are heat-welded for a strong, watertight bond. It's a reliable choice for many commercial and some residential properties.
While RV roof sealant is designed for recreational vehicles, some of its properties might be applicable to very minor, temporary repairs on other roof types in Baltimore. However, licensed pros generally recommend using sealants specifically formulated for residential or commercial roofing materials. Using the wrong product can lead to ineffective repairs or even further damage, so it's best to stick to specialized products.
